This is probably the most gamebreaking exploit I have posted here so far, though it requires some effort to use. This is mainly because it requires exalted with the netherwing drake faction based in Outland, Shadowmoon Valley.

The point of this reputation grind is to affiliate yourself with the netherwing drakes of Shadowmoon Valley and infiltrate their aggressors, the Dragonmaw Orcs using an orc disguise. You perform duties for the Dragonmaw while simultaneouly sabotaging them and ultimately rising through their hierarchy.

How the exploit works and what it does: when you reach exalted with this faction a quest opens up entitled "Lord Illidan Stormrage", the ultimate master of the Dragonmaw, where upon Stormrage sees through your disguise and imprisons you in a magical field. Technically, this is a buff called "Mark Of Stormrage".

If you enter a port (say lfd, lfr or a battleground) while imprisoned, you will be stunned for the duration of the debuff (1 minute). When it expires, you will no longer be able to target any mob, and mobs will not aggro you. They act as if you are not there even if you walk straight through them. 

You can target friendly players when in this special state and can heal them. Healers will not take damage and can stay rooted to the spot ignoring game mechanics. Moreover, my experimentation with a low-level guardian pet trinket (I was using a priest) showed that pets under your control can still aggro and attack bosses (that was one pissed-off raid group:)), meaning that warlocks and hunters should be able to continuously summon pets while invincible. 

In theory, a small team of pet-using classes should be able to kill virtually anything. You can't do it solo because if a pet gets one-shot the fight resets, but with multiple players continuously summoning you only have avoid all of the pets being killed in the same moment.

There are many other possible uses. You can cancel the buff simply by re-logging allowing the player to skip to the end of instances quickly.

The buff persists through death. It works in-world and in pve instances: it seems to do nothing in pvp other than stop you rezzing at the gy.

What is most striking about this buff: it has been in the game for an unbelievable ten years. During all that time it has never been fixed.
